I knew there had to be a reason why my hangover was magically cured Monday morning — Benny Hinn was in town!

The mega-televangelist brought his  Benny Hinn Ministries healing sideshow to the Pepsi Center for the first time in three years, drawing thousands of believers for the 2008 Denver Holy Spirit Miracle Crusade. Although the video clip below doesn’t feature any large-scale audience takedowns as witnessed in other cities, Hinn (who’s currently under investigation by the U.S. Congress for his lavish spending) was able to elicit all manner of fainting and flopping from the sick and elderly. As Hinn’s website says, “Get ready for your faith to explode!” — Jared Jacang Maher
